520 |a This paper is aimed to study the use of super (a; d)-H antimagic total graph on generating en- cryption keys that can be used to establish a stream cipher. Methodology to achieve this goal was undertaken in three steps. First of all the existence of super (a; d)-H-antimagic total labeling was proven. At the second step, the algorithm for utilizing the labeling to construct a key stream was developed, and finally, the mechanism for applying the key to establish a stream cipher was constructed. As the result, according to the security analysis, it can be shown that the developed cryptographic system achieve a good security.
